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in San Carlos, Costa Rica
San Carlos boasts a wealth of attractions for every type of traveller.
- Arenal Volcano National Park: While technically not *in* San Carlos, it's a short trip away and a must-see. Witness the majestic volcano and its surrounding rainforest.
- La Fortuna Waterfall: Another nearby gem, perfect for a refreshing dip in the cool waters at the base of the falls.
- Rio Celeste: Hike to this stunning river, known for its vibrant blue waters, a result of mineral deposits.
- Caño Negro Wildlife Refuge: Embark on a boat tour through this incredible wetland, teeming with diverse wildlife, including monkeys, birds, and caimans.

Best Zones & Areas to Explore in San Carlos, Costa Rica
San Carlos is comprised of various charming areas, each with its own unique character.
- Ciudad Quesada: The main town, offering a mix of local life and tourist amenities.
- Los Chiles: A gateway to the Caño Negro Wildlife Refuge, perfect for nature lovers.
- Venado Caves: Explore the fascinating underground world of these ancient caves.

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in San Carlos, Costa Rica
Indulge in the delicious flavours of Costa Rican cuisine. Sample traditional dishes like gallo pinto (rice and beans), casado (a typical lunch plate), and fresh tropical fruits. Don't miss the opportunity to try local specialties at sodas (small, family-run restaurants).

Best Time to Visit San Carlos, Costa Rica
The dry season (December to April) offers the best weather for outdoor activities. However, the shoulder seasons (May-June and September-November) offer fewer crowds and pleasant temperatures.
Transportation Options in San Carlos, Costa Rica
Getting around San Carlos is relatively straightforward. Local buses are readily available and offer an affordable way to travel between towns and villages.
